Our supported living accommodation, provided with the specific aim of promoting independence.

Each dwelling is totally independent, with its own bathroom, kitchen, lounge and bedroom. Thedwellings are fully furnished with modern standard furniture, full set of cutlery, cooking utensils and bedding.

All our dwellings have suitable floor coverings to all rooms hall and stairway, suitable curtains / blinds to all windows, suitable lamp shades or appropriate light fittings, outside washing line, television aerial, smoke and fire alarms

Our aim is to empower the young persons to be individually responsible for their own environment and lifestyle.

We aim to teach young people life skills such as:Social life and Recreational skillsAccessing training and educational skillsPersonal hygiene | Booking for Holidays and Supporting on Holiday | Accessing welfare benefits | Maintaining their tenanciesEnsuring bills such as rent, debts, gas, electricity, water are paid.

24/7 Support UK Ltd is a crisis intervention independent living support service for young peoplewho have experienced a crisis, family breakdown and other life challenges.

Our person centeredapproaches consist of dedicated 24hour/7 days a week staffed accommodation for young peopleaged 1618. With exceptional arrangements with placing local authorities we can offeraccommodation to under 16yearold or over 18 year olds.

We support Young Offenders, YoungPeople with behaviour issues, Unaccompanied young asylum seekers, Young people withlearning disabilities and complex needs, Vulnerable young people who would have gone through abuse of different types.

We enable young people to develop essential skills required to achieve independence and drive up maturity through giving them space they need to reflect upon previous incidents, behaviours, actions and consequences, enabling young people to release old behaviours and adopt a new positive perception to living.

We operate a key worker/mentor system within

all our independent support services. A dedicated staff team is supported and managed by The Service Managers.

This is to: • Provide a person centred support approach through named keyworker / mentor, with whom the young person will have the opportunity to develop an appropriate working relationship.

• To enable a consistent approach.

• To ensure that the young person’s information is collected and collated so as to accurately reflect the up to date therapeutic support needs of the young person, within the relevant person centred plans. So that appropriate and informed decisions can be made by the young person, or certainly other professionals involved, and positively contribute to the young person’s constant reviews.
